I read the pdf and it says divide by 10 if measuring on the x10. MEASURING LINE CURRENT Plug the Line Splitter into a standard 120V AC grounded receptacle. Plug the load’s power cord into the Line Splitter. Place the jaws of the current clamp around the X1 or X10 opening of the Line Splitter. Turn on the load so it is drawing power. Read the current measurement directly if clamped around the X1 opening. Divide the reading by 10 if clamped around the X10 opening.
